В наше время все больше людей предпочитают использовать личные кабинеты для управления своими услугами и персональной информацией. Личный кабинет позволяет получить доступ и контролировать различные сервисы, такие как онлайн-банкинг, электронная почта, социальные сети и многое другое. Создать и установить собственный личный кабинет может показаться сложной задачей, но с нашим подробным руководством вы сможете легко освоить этот процесс.
Первым шагом в создании личного кабинета является выбор платформы или сервиса, на котором будет работать ваш кабинет. Имеется множество вариантов, в зависимости от ваших потребностей и предпочтений. Некоторые из самых популярных платформ включают WordPress, Joomla и Drupal. Рекомендуется выбрать платформу, которая наиболее соответствует вашим потребностям и в которой вы удобно себя чувствуете.
После выбора платформы следующим шагом будет установка и настройка личного кабинета. Это включает в себя загрузку и установку соответствующего программного обеспечения на ваш хостинг. Обычно, для этого необходимо скачать файлы с официального сайта платформы и загрузить их на хостинг с помощью FTP-клиента. Затем требуется запустить процесс установки, который будет проводиться пошагово и может включать создание базы данных и указание параметров конфигурации.
После успешной установки можно приступить к настройке личного кабинета. Это включает в себя выбор темы и расширений, которые подходят вам лучше всего. Тема определяет внешний вид и макет вашего кабинета, а расширения добавляют дополнительные функции и возможности. Вы можете выбрать тему из предложенных вариантов или создать собственную, а также выбрать нужные расширения из многочисленных доступных в каталоге платформы.
Подготовка к созданию личного кабинета
Перед тем, как приступить к созданию личного кабинета, необходимо провести предварительные шаги для подготовки.
1. Определение целей и функционала. Прежде чем начать разрабатывать личный кабинет, необходимо определить, какие конкретные цели вы хотите достичь и какой функционал должен быть реализован. Необходимо провести анализ требований и выработать четкую концепцию.
2. Исследование пользователей и анализ конкурентов. Разработка личного кабинета должна исходить из потребностей пользователей. Проведите исследование вашей целевой аудитории и изучите, какие решения уже предлагают конкуренты. Это поможет определиться с уникальными особенностями и преимуществами вашего личного кабинета.
3. Разработка пользовательского пути. Определите последовательность действий, которую будет выполнять пользователь в личном кабинете. Разбейте этот путь на этапы и создайте соответствующие страницы и функционал для каждого из них.
4. Проектирование интерфейса. Основываясь на полученных данных и анализе пользовательского пути, разработайте дизайн личного кабинета. Учитывайте удобство использования, эстетический вид и соблюдение бренд-идентичности.
5. Создание структуры базы данных. Определите, какие данные необходимо хранить в личном кабинете и разработайте соответствующую структуру базы данных.
6. Выбор и подготовка технического стека. Определитесь с технологиями и инструментами, которые будете использовать для создания личного кабинета. Подготовьте среду разработки и необходимые библиотеки или фреймворки.
Важно отметить, что подготовительные шаги могут занимать значительное время, но хорошо проведенная подготовка сократит количество ошибок и повысит качество и удобство использования личного кабинета в дальнейшем.
Выбор целевой аудитории
Определение целевой аудитории важно для правильного выбора функционала и дизайна личного кабинета. Важно понять, какие задачи будет выполнять ваша аудитория с помощью вашего личного кабинета и на основе этого разработать соответствующие возможности.
Для определения целевой аудитории вы можете провести маркетинговые исследования, анализ конкурентов, опросы целевой аудитории и т.д. Важно узнать, кто является основной группой пользователей вашей платформы и что они ожидают получить от личного кабинета.
При выборе целевой аудитории также важно учитывать ее особенности и потребности. Разработайте дружественный и интуитивно понятный интерфейс, который будет удобен для ваших пользователей.
Также помните, что целевая аудитория может быть динамической и с течением времени ваши пользователи могут меняться. Постоянно анализируйте и обновляйте свою целевую аудиторию, чтобы удовлетворять их потребности и ожидания.
Определение функциональности
Основные функции, часто включаемые в личный кабинет:
- Регистрация и авторизация: пользователи могут создавать учетные записи и входить в систему с помощью логина и пароля.
- Профиль пользователя: пользователи могут управлять своей персональной информацией, такой как имя, контактные данные или предпочитаемый язык.
- Управление учетной записью: пользователи могут изменять свои настройки, такие как пароль, адрес электронной почты или изображение профиля.
- Обзор и редактирование заказов: пользователи могут просматривать свои заказы, редактировать информацию или отслеживать статус доставки.
- Управление подписками и уведомлениями: пользователи могут подписываться на рассылки, управлять своими предпочтениями уведомлений или отменять подписку.
- Отзывы и оценки: пользователи могут оставлять отзывы о продуктах или услугах, а также ставить оценки.
- Финансовые операции: пользователи могут просматривать информацию о своих платежах, совершать транзакции или управлять своими банковскими данными.
- Техническая поддержка: пользователи могут обращаться за помощью или задавать вопросы по функциональности личного кабинета.
Зависимо от специфики бизнеса или целевой аудитории, личный кабинет может включать дополнительные функции, такие как:
- Получение персональных рекомендаций и предложений.
- Организация событий, встреч или вебинаров.
- Онлайн-консультации и обратная связь.
- Управление аккаунтами социальных сетей.
- Совместное редактирование документов и файлов.
Имея понимание функциональности личного кабинета, разработчики и дизайнеры могут определить требования к системе, чтобы создать пользовательский опыт, наиболее соответствующий потребностям конечных пользователей.
Проектирование личного кабинета
Перед началом проектирования необходимо провести анализ требований и потребностей пользователей. Необходимо понять, какие функциональные возможности должны быть доступны в личном кабинете и какие данные и информацию пользователи ожидают увидеть. Это поможет избежать создания избыточной или недостаточной функциональности в личном кабинете.
Для создания удобного интерфейса необходимо учесть принципы юзабилити (пользовательских свойств) и удобства использования. Четкая навигация, понятные и интуитивно понятные элементы управления, а также простой и понятный дизайн помогут пользователям быстро ориентироваться в личном кабинете.
Один из важных аспектов проектирования - эффективное расположение информации и элементов управления. Необходимо определить главные разделы и вкладки личного кабинета, чтобы пользователю было легко находить нужную ему информацию и функциональность. Также важно рассмотреть возможность иерархического отображения информации для более удобного доступа к данным.
Помимо этого, важно уделить внимание визуальному оформлению личного кабинета. Цветовая палитра, типографика, использование графических элементов - все это поможет создать приятный и стильный дизайн. Важно подобрать шрифты и размеры текста так, чтобы они были удобны для чтения на различных устройствах.
В ходе проектирования личного кабинета также стоит учесть возможность адаптивности. Личный кабинет должен хорошо работать и выглядеть на различных устройствах - от компьютеров до мобильных телефонов. Удобство использования личного кабинета на мобильных устройствах особенно важно, так как все больше пользователей предпочитают использовать их для доступа к интернет-сервисам.
В итоге, хорошо спроектированный личный кабинет поможет пользователям легко управлять своими данными, получать доступ к нужной информации и выполнять нужные действия. Это повысит удовлетворенность пользователей и поможет вашему интернет-сервису привлечь и удержать больше пользователей.
Создание дизайна интерфейса
Дизайн интерфейса вашего личного кабинета играет важную роль в создании удобного и привлекательного пользовательского опыта. Ответственно подходите к его разработке, чтобы пользователи могли легко ориентироваться и выполнять необходимые действия.
При создании дизайна интерфейса личного кабинета учитывайте следующие аспекты:
- Цветовая палитра. Выберите гармоничные цвета, которые соответствуют вашему бренду. Они должны поддерживать создание приятной и привлекательной атмосферы.
- Типографика. Используйте читабельные и эстетически приятные шрифты для текстовых элементов интерфейса. Обратите внимание на размер, выравнивание и расстояние между текстом.
- Иконки и изображения. Используйте значки и графические элементы для визуализации различных действий и функций. Они должны быть понятны и соответствовать контексту использования.
- Расположение элементов. Подумайте о логическом расположении элементов интерфейса. Разместите наиболее важные и часто используемые функции в простую и доступную часть экрана.
- Адаптивный дизайн. Учтите, что ваш личный кабинет может использоваться на разных устройствах и разрешениях экранов. Обеспечьте гибкость и адаптивность интерфейса для комфортного использования на всех устройствах.
Не забывайте о тестировании и получении обратной связи от пользователей. Это поможет вам улучшить дизайн интерфейса и сделать его более интуитивно понятным и функциональным.
Разработка структуры кабинета
Перед тем, как приступить к созданию личного кабинета, необходимо продумать его структуру. Ведь именно структура определяет удобство использования для конечного пользователя.
1. Определите основные разделы. Размышляйте, какие функции вы хотели бы предоставить пользователям в личном кабинете. Например, это могут быть разделы "Профиль", "Настройки", "История заказов" и т.д.
2. Распределите функционал по разделам. Определитесь, какие функции будут доступны в каждом разделе. Например, в разделе "Профиль" пользователь сможет редактировать свои персональные данные, в разделе "Настройки" - менять настройки уведомлений и прочее.
3. Создайте навигацию. Разместите ссылки на разделы личного кабинета в удобном для пользователей месте, чтобы они могли быстро и без проблем переходить между разделами.
4. Учтите масштабируемость. Если у вас есть планы на развитие кабинета или добавление новых функций в будущем, обязательно учтите этот факт при разработке структуры. Предусмотрите возможности для добавления новых разделов и функций без необходимости менять всю структуру в будущем.
Следуя этим простым шагам, вы сможете разработать структуру личного кабинета, которая будет проста в использовании и удовлетворит потребности ваших пользователей.
Реализация личного кабинета
1. Определение функциональности: первым шагом при создании личного кабинета является определение его функциональности и необходимых возможностей. Это может включать в себя такие функции, как регистрация пользователей, авторизация, просмотр и редактирование профиля, возможность добавления и удаления данных и другие.
2. Проектирование интерфейса: после определения функциональности следующий шаг - это проектирование интерфейса личного кабинета. Необходимо создать удобный и интуитивно понятный интерфейс, который будет соответствовать потребностям пользователей.
3. Создание базы данных: для хранения информации о пользователях и их данных необходимо создать базу данных. В ней будут храниться все данные, связанные с личным кабинетом - от логинов и паролей до информации о профиле пользователя.
4. Реализация серверной логики: следующий шаг - это реализация серверной логики личного кабинета. Для этого можно использовать язык программирования, такой как PHP, Python или JavaScript, и фреймворк, который упростит создание серверной части приложения.
5. Создание клиентской части: после реализации серверной логики следует разработка клиентской части личного кабинета. Здесь можно использовать HTML, CSS и JavaScript для создания пользовательского интерфейса и взаимодействия с сервером.
6. Тестирование и отладка: после завершения разработки необходимо протестировать личный кабинет и исправить все ошибки и недочеты. Тестирование позволит убедиться, что все функции работают корректно и пользователь может без проблем использовать созданный личный кабинет.
7. Установка на сервер: после успешного тестирования можно приступать к установке личного кабинета на сервер. Здесь необходимо следовать инструкциям хостинг-провайдера или администратора сервера, чтобы правильно настроить и развернуть приложение.
8. Доработка и поддержка: после установки личного кабинета может потребоваться его доработка или добавление новых функций. Также необходимо обеспечить его поддержку и регулярное обновление, чтобы гарантировать его безопасность и функциональность.
Все эти шаги являются основными при реализации личного кабинета. Они могут варьироваться в зависимости от конкретных требований и специфики проекта. Однако, следуя этому руководству, вы сможете создать и установить свой собственный личный кабинет.
Выбор языка программирования
На рынке существует множество языков программирования, каждый со своими преимуществами и особенностями. В вашем выборе следует ориентироваться на такие факторы, как:
1. Цель проекта: определите, для чего будет использоваться ваш личный кабинет. Если это, например, простой блог или сайт визитка, то для создания его, возможно, будет достаточно использовать простые и распространенные языки, такие как HTML, CSS и JavaScript. Однако, если вы планируете создать сложное веб-приложение или у вас уже есть некоторые специфические требования, то вам, вероятно, потребуется использовать языки программирования, такие как PHP, Python, Ruby или Java.
2. Опыт и знания: обратите внимание на свои личные навыки и опыт в программировании. Если у вас есть высокий уровень знаний и опыта в каком-то конкретном языке программирования, то вы можете выбрать его для создания своего личного кабинета. В случае отсутствия опыта выбирайте язык с простым синтаксисом, который можно быстро освоить.
3. Сообщество и поддержка: учтите, что выбранный вами язык программирования должен иметь активное сообщество разработчиков и достаточное количество материалов и учебных пособий для изучения. Таким образом, вы сможете получать помощь и поддержку, если столкнетесь с вопросами или проблемами при разработке своего личного кабинета.
4. Расширяемость: учтите, что в будущем возможно будет необходимо добавить новые функции или модули в ваш личный кабинет. Поэтому важно выбрать язык программирования, который позволит легко расширять функциональность вашего кабинета.
В конечном счете, выбор языка программирования для создания и установки вашего личного кабинета зависит только от ваших желаний и потребностей. Важно тщательно продумать все факторы и выбрать тот язык программирования, который наилучшим образом подходит для вашего проекта.
Создание базы данных
Для создания базы данных можно использовать различные системы управления базами данных (СУБД), такие как MySQL, PostgreSQL, Microsoft SQL Server и другие. В зависимости от выбранной СУБД, процесс создания базы данных может немного различаться.
Основные шаги при создании базы данных обычно включают в себя:
- Установка и настройка выбранной СУБД на сервере.
- Создание новой базы данных с помощью команды или графического интерфейса СУБД.
- Настройка таблиц и полей в базе данных для хранения необходимой информации.
- Установка прав доступа к базе данных для пользователя личного кабинета.
Важно учитывать требования безопасности при создании базы данных. Необходимо использовать сильные пароли, ограничить доступ к базе данных только необходимым пользователям и регулярно обновлять СУБД и ее компоненты.
Тестирование личного кабинета
Шаг 1: Проверка функциональности
Перед началом тестирования убедитесь, что все функции вашего личного кабинета работают корректно. Это включает в себя проверку возможности регистрации, входа в систему, изменения пароля, обновления данных профиля и др.
Шаг 2: Тестирование интерфейса
Уделяйте внимание дизайну и удобству использования. Убедитесь, что все элементы интерфейса, такие как кнопки, ссылки, формы и меню, работают правильно и соответствуют дизайну вашего личного кабинета.
Шаг 3: Проверка безопасности
При тестировании личного кабинета обратите внимание на безопасность. Убедитесь, что система защиты данных и информации пользователя работает должным образом, включая проверку наличия защиты от несанкционированного доступа и возможных уязвимостей.
Шаг 4: Тестирование на разных устройствах и браузерах
Проверьте работу и отображение вашего личного кабинета на разных устройствах, таких как компьютер, планшет и смартфон, а также в различных браузерах, таких как Google Chrome, Mozilla Firefox, Safari и др. Убедитесь, что все функции и элементы интерфейса работают корректно и отображаются правильно.
Шаг 5: Проверка на производительность
Оцените производительность вашего личного кабинета, проверив время загрузки страниц, время отклика системы и другие показатели производительности. Обратите внимание на возможные узкие места и оптимизируйте код и настройки системы, чтобы достичь лучшей производительности.
Шаг 6: Регистрация пользоателя и передача данных
Протестируйте процесс регистрации нового пользователя и передачи данных, таких как заказы, платежи и сообщения. Убедитесь, что все данные правильно передаются и сохраняются, а также проверьте работу соответствующих оповещений и уведомлений.
Следуя этим шагам, вы сможете тщательно протестировать ваш личный кабинет и гарантировать его качество и функциональность перед запуском.
Подготовка тестовых данных
Прежде чем приступить к созданию и установке личного кабинета, необходимо корректно подготовить тестовые данные, чтобы они максимально соответствовали реальным условиям использования.
Для начала определите список данных, которые вам необходимы. Это может включать такую информацию, как имя пользователя, электронный адрес, пароль, адрес проживания и другие.
Затем создайте таблицу для хранения тестовых данных. Используйте тег <table>
для создания таблицы и добавьте заголовки столбцов, чтобы они отражали необходимую информацию. Например:
Имя пользователя | Электронный адрес | Пароль |
---|---|---|
Иванов Иван | ivanov@example.com | qwerty123 |
Петрова Анна | petrova@example.com | password456 |
Заполните таблицу данными, которые позволят вам протестировать различные сценарии использования личного кабинета. Не забудьте предусмотреть все возможные варианты ввода данных, чтобы проверить работу системы в разных условиях.
Кроме того, обратите внимание на то, что для надежности тестирования стоит создать достаточное количество тестовых записей. Это позволит проверить работу системы при большой нагрузке и убедиться в ее стабильности и надежности.